That is bad, but I think the right ones to blame are the kate developers
here, because we simply have no proper path to go available.

KDevelop won't work properly with KDE 4.5 if we don't adapt it during the
development cycle of KDE 4.5, and thus we inherently cannot wait for KDE 4.5
to be released just to start adapting KDevelop _then_.

Maybe we should just split the development line into two paths:
One towards KDevelop 4.0.1 which can depend on KDE 4.4, and the trunk which
should go towards KDevelop 4.1, and which should depend on KDE 4.5.

Those who cannot check out kdelibs trunk can work in the KDevelop 4.0.1
branch, and the changes can at random points be ported upwards to trunk.

We could also call them 4.1 and 4.2. Whether we have enough features to
warrant a new minor release simply doesn't matter, I'm sure users will also
be happy with a minor release that simply keeps the app running in a changin
environment.

Except many people *can't* develop for the next version in master if
it requires KDE 4.5.

I won't get KDE 4.5 until it officially arrives to Debian. KDE 4.4
wasn't available in Debian Squeeze until 4.4.3 was already released,
and I don't expect them to be any faster for 4.5.

Compiling a beta version of KDE from source and installing it on my
*only* computer is not an option.
